IC: Commander Rast
Only Rast's eyes shifted to watch as the Quarren was suddenly caught up in the Force and throttled. The rest of him remained still and impassive as he continued to stand at attention, head held high and facing straight ahead.
The crazy fool
, he thought.
Disinterestedly, he wondered to himself if Vile was going to die right then and there just before Lord Shadra decided to show his mercy. Scenes such as this caused many officers to tremble in their uniforms anytime they were in the presence of a Sith lord. But Rast had long since grown accustomed to it. After all, he knew the Sith weren't looking for his fear, they were looking for his commitment. And so long as Rast accomplished his duties and knew his place, he felt quite secure, even in the midst of men as dangerous and powerful as Darth Shadra himself.
With their assignment now clear, the two bickering Sith left the chambers. Rast knew he had to see to his own preparations.
"My lord," he nodded, before turning to the man beside him. "Admiral."
Exiting down the corridor, Rast spied Governor Hulnare, who, fortunately, seemed too involved with a young woman to notice him.
Lord Shadra had made it quite clear that the secrecy of this mission was paramount. Even the Governor wasn't to know. Perhaps Shadra even suspected the man himself with being involved with the mysterious disappearances. The disturbing thing about them remained the lack of suspects. There were even reports now of similar incidents in the Republic. And Rast knew well that
his
teams weren't behind them...
Looks like its finally time to get in gear and find out just what the hell is going on, then.

IC: Admiral Kaos Vynn
Vynn stood stock still and watched impassively as the impulsive apprentice was disciplined. His long years in the service of the Sith Empire had taught him that it was wise to keep your mouth shut when in the presence of your superiors unless your input was implicitly requested. Even then it was wise to tread lightly and tell them what they wanted to hear, mostly. This show of blatant disrespect and insubordination to a Sith master was bad enough, but to do so in front of Darth Shadra was unforgivable. If it wasn't for the fact that this task required his involvement, this apprentice, this Vile, would be dead.
Once this little argument had ended, he left, bowing to Darth Shadra and nodding curtly to Commander Rast. He strode from the chamber with long, purposeful strides. He moved with the confidence born from a lifetime at the helm of a Sith Dreadnought. He walked past the Governor, who was too wrapped up in his petty conquest to notice him. Vynn had always seen the governor as a glorified steward. He knew that Shadra had the final say in things. As he moved within earshot of the man, he hissed,
"Don't you have anything better to do, Governor?"
Without breaking his gait, he continued on, going to see to his preparations. While this mission wasn't his usual thing, he planned to execute his given role expertly. Darth Shadra would see once again why he was the top man in the Sith Navy. He had served the Empire loyally for some 18 years, and he didn't plan to stop until he died.

IC: Governer Exemplar Gregor Hulnare
"So, my dear, are you interested? I can make a very pleasing life for you, you know." Gregor could tell he was getting close. She, of course, looked slightly abhorred, but he could see the greed glistening in her eyes as well. She certainly would not mind the benefits he offered... it was merely what she would have to do with Gregor to get them that still unnerved him. Gregor could never understand this, as he had been told he was an attractive man. Perhaps women simply found him intimidating. Certainly, his position warranted it. Just then, his little meeting was interrupted by a hardly vocalized voice.
"Don't you have anything better to do, Governor?"
Gregor looked over at the passing man for only a moment, but it was enough for the young girl to make up her mind and slip away, running as fast as she could. Gregor cursed under his breath. His plan was ruined. She'd never come within twenty feet of him again. He watched after her as she ran away. She certainly was beautiful. She dropped her datapad, but didn't stop to pick it up.
Pity she didn't drop more than that.
Gregor found himself thinking. He then turned to look at the back of the man that had so rudely ruined his plans for the future.
He noticed that it was Admiral Kaos Vynn. He sneered at the man's back. How dare he interrupt like that? Such a rude comment.... and then running away as he did? Gregor found himself calling after the man. "I see, run away. Make your accusations and leave. You fleet people are always like that, aren't you?" He then paused a moment to see if he would get any response.
